What's Luke Bryan's Net Worth?
Many people want to know about Luke Bryan's net worth. As of 2025, his estimated net worth is around $160 million. This figure comes from sources like Celebrity Net Worth, which tracks the financial standings of famous individuals. It's a pretty big sum, to be honest, and it reflects his long and very successful career in the music business.
This amount really shows the impact he has made as a country music artist. He's also a television personality, and someone who has ventured into various business areas. His financial success is, you know, a clear sign of his widespread appeal and hard work over the years. It's quite something to consider, isn't it?
The money he has accumulated stems from a steady flow of different activities. This includes his music sales, the very profitable concert tours he puts on, and the money he earns from writing songs. Plus, he gets income from his high-profile television appearances and other ventures. It's a diverse set of earnings, that.

Album Sales and Music Royalties
Of course, a country singer’s income also heavily relies on their recorded music. Album sales, whether they are physical copies or digital downloads, contribute significantly to his net worth. Even in this age of streaming, album sales still bring in a considerable amount of money, you know?
Beyond direct sales, there are also music royalties. These are payments made to artists and songwriters whenever their music is played publicly. This includes plays on the radio, on streaming services, in television shows, or even in commercials. It's a consistent, passive income stream that builds up over time, especially for someone with a large catalog of popular songs, like your Luke Bryan.
Every time one of his hits is streamed or broadcast, a small payment comes his way. These small payments, when added up across millions of plays, become a very substantial sum. It's a vital part of his overall earnings, actually, and continues to contribute long after an album is first released.

Songwriting Royalties
It’s important to remember that Luke Bryan isn't just a singer; he's also a talented songwriter. Many of his biggest hits, and even songs recorded by other artists, carry his writing credit. This means he earns songwriting royalties, which are separate from the performance royalties mentioned earlier, you see.
Whenever a song he has written is performed, recorded, or used commercially, he receives a payment. This can be a very steady and long-lasting source of income, as popular songs can generate royalties for decades.
